A: A patroon stofafscheiderfilter is a cartridge-style dust separator filter designed to capture fine particles and contaminants from air systems. It is commonly used in industrial ventilation and HVAC systems to improve air quality. Its modular design allows for easy replacement and maintenance.
A: A koolstof lucht filter patroon (carbon air filter cartridge) should typically be replaced every 6–12 months, depending on usage and air quality requirements. Regular inspections for clogging or reduced airflow can help determine replacement timing. Always follow the manufacturer’s guidelines for optimal performance.

A: Most patroon stofafscheiderfilter units are designed for replacement rather than cleaning, as accumulated debris can compromise efficiency. Some heavy-duty models may allow limited cleaning, but this varies by design. Always check the product specifications for maintenance instructions.
A: A koolstof lucht filter patroon combines carbon adsorption with particulate filtration, removing odors, gases, and particles simultaneously. It offers longer lifespan and higher efficiency compared to basic filters. This makes it ideal for environments requiring both air purification and odor control.
